Are Returned items resold
Once a product is returned, the retailer has to foot the cost for assessing the item and repackaging it. A like-new item or piece of clothing might be able to be resold at full cost. But most returns are used or damaged. A recent retail survey found that less than half of all goods can be resold at full cost.

Do stores keep track of returns
At least a dozen major retailers are discreetly tracking shoppers’ returns and punishing people who are suspected of abusing their return policies. Amazon, Best Buy, Home Depot, and Victoria’s Secret are among the many retailers engaging in this practice. … Retailers say they use the service to combat return fraud.

Why do stores take your ID for returns
Stores will often ask you to show your driver’s license (or other government-issued ID) when you return a purchase and then record your information along with information about the returned items to help identify patterns of return fraud or abuse.
